Travelling Images : Transport in Painting & Posters

UPDATED 20160822 12:23:25

This course will explore the way in which transport as a theme has been approached by a wide range of artists in paintings & posters, during mainly the 19th & 20th Centuries - many examples will be included, fully illustrated with discussion.
